SB 281 Michigan Senate · 2025-2026 Regular Session

Recreation: state parks; recreation passport and nonresident motor vehicle park passes; modify. Amends secs. 2001, 2045, 74101, 74116, 74117, 74120, 78101, 78105 & 78119 of 1994 PA 451 (MCL 324.2001 et seq.). TIE BAR WITH: SB 280'25

Senate Bill 281 modifies how Michigan's recreation passport fees, used for state parks and now also state-operated public boating access sites, are defined and distributed. It revises the allocation percentages of these fees, directing a larger share towards state park improvements and increasing funding for local public recreation facilities. Additionally, the bill creates a new program to provide grants to local governments and nonprofits for water trail development. Finally, it mandates an annual appropriation from the state's general fund to cover estimated recreation passport fees not collected from certain exempt motor vehicles, ensuring these funds are still used for recreation.
